Accidents happen To the E ditor : t started for m^ when I was 12. The year was 1972, and the election was Nixon-McGovem. My sixth-grade scxzial studies teacher, Ms. M<x)re, asked the class to divide by who would vote for each candidate, and it ended up that she and I were the only ones on the McGovern side of the rixim. We spent the next hour and much of the week debating the merits of the two candidates. It was a time I’ll never forget—perhaps my first sense that the minority can often be right. My first taste of a Jew standing with a black person, my teacher, and how that dynamic could work. I don’t think I’ve missed a presidential elec tion since then—Carter, Mondale, Dukakis, Clinton, Gore and now Kerry. The elections have always been important, but I’ve never felt that the results could actually endanger me physically. I’m now concerned that this admin istration may “accidentally” push the button or take us to war unnecessarily again. At 43,1 don’t believe this country can afford another four years of George Bush & Co. It’s just trx) dangerous for Americans and the peoples of the world.
